Title: Are smokepop belts worth it?
Post by: MeowRailroad on July 16, 2017, 08:11:08 PM
Does it make sense for my colonists to wear smokepop belts or should I avoid making them? Do they help much in combat? I could see them helping if I was attacking a item stash or outpost with turrets, but do they help for base defense?

Post by: Trylobyte on July 17, 2017, 12:44:48 AM
They help your ranged guys out a bit - A layer of defense on top of all the other layers of defense a good fortification can provide melee guys can make them nearly unhittable.  For melee you're better off with shield belts, but for ranged guys smokepop belts are nice.
